The Bwabwata National Park is located along the Kwando River, which flows into the Chobe River, forming the border between the Zambezi Region of Namibia and Botswana.
Previously known as the Caprivi Strip, the Zambezi Region is located in the far north-eastern corner of the country and forms part of the Kavango Zambezi Transfrontier Park.
KAZA is the second-largest nature conservation area in the world and is criss-crossed by enormous rivers, marshlands, and deltas.

Accommodation Options at Namushasha River Campsite
Campsites
Six spacious campsites are set out on the green lawns, under beautiful shade trees on the banks of the Kwando River. Each site has private ablution facilities, including hot water showers. Electricity connection points, lights, and barbecue facilities are available.
